Latest Release In Woburn Sands This Weekend

Posted 16 March 2022 by Keith Osborne

Our Housebuilder of the Year, Hayfield, launches the final phase of Hayfield Oaks on Saturday 19 March...

A new phase of seven two- and three-bedroom houses featuring a zero-carbon ready specification will be launched to the market at Hayfield Oaks in Woburn Sands, Buckinghamshire, on Saturday 19 March.

With architecture inspired by the Arts and Crafts era, the new detached and semi-detached homes will be priced from £395,000.

Located off Newport Road, the new homes will create the final phase of Hayfield Oaks, which features a total of 65 luxury residences, set amongst mature trees. The spacious development has been designed around a central play area with enhanced hard landscaping, conservation-style block paving and an impressive feature entrance.

Kelly Sharman, sales and marketing director at WhatHouse? Housebuilder of the Year Hayfield, said: “We are so pleased to be able to deliver this final phase of Hayfield Oaks to the market, as all the private homes in the first phase had four or five bedrooms. We knew how much pent-up demand there was for high specification smaller homes in this prime location and were delighted to be given the green light for these additional homes from Milton Keynes Council.

‘Fairford’‘Fairford’ house type

“These seven new two- and three-bedroom properties will feature Hayfield’s zero-carbon ready specification, including air source heat pumps, electric vehicle fast-charging points, and energy-efficient underfloor heating. This will be complemented by luxury interior details such as built-in wardrobes, Farrow & Ball paint, Heritage bronze ironmongery and Ring doorbells. We are really looking forward to releasing these beautiful new homes for sale on Saturday 19 March and would urge all those interested to make quick contact with us.”

The first homes to be released in the new phase will include a two-bedroom ‘Lulsley’ house priced at £395,000, and three-bedroom ‘Fairford’ designs, priced from £480,000. Three-bedroom ‘Hawford’ homes will be released for sale at a later stage. The new homes will be ready to move into from the autumn. The final phase of Hayfield Oaks will be sold from the sister development, Hayfield Walk, located in the Buckinghamshire village of Hanslope, which is a 20-minute drive from Woburn Sands.

Hayfield Oaks’ unique house designs are constructed in red brick, with render features and part-tiled hanging elevations. Each bespoke kitchen includes a range of built-in Bosch appliances, Karndean flooring, and French doors leading to the private garden. The contemporary bathroom suites are by ROCA. All homes have underfloor heating throughout the ground floor. Built-in wardrobes are installed into the principal bedroom.

Woburn Sands’ quaint high street, quality amenities, excellent schooling and access to breathtaking countryside make the historic town one of the most desirable places to live in the region. Hayfield Oaks is only half-a-mile from Woburn Sands train station, which appeals to those wishing to travel for work or pleasure. By changing at Bletchley, it is possible to travel to London Euston in around one hour.
